What's Happening?
The Comstock Mining Company, historically linked to the Comstock Silver Lode in Virginia City, Nevada, is leveraging advanced technologies to enhance silver extraction efficiency by 35% as of 2025. This historic mine, discovered in 1859, was the first
major silver deposit in North America and played a significant role in transforming Nevada's economy. The company is now utilizing state-of-the-art methods such as 3D geological modeling, drone-assisted surveys, and AI-driven decision tools to improve mining operations. These innovations are part of a broader effort to maintain high production levels while ensuring environmental responsibility. The company has also implemented water recycling and land reclamation technologies to minimize ecological impact.
